Australian PM Morrison: Budget will be delayed to October

At a regular news briefing on Friday, Australia’s Prime Minister (PM) Morrison announced that the budget will be delayed to October.

Further comments

Taking decisions on the basis that coronavirus will last at least six months.

Will not hand down budget until October.

States and territories working to similar timetables.

Idea that you can put together forecast around economy at this time is not sensible.

Reconsider the need for unnecessary travel in school holidays.

In national interest for schools to remain open.

To restrict travel into remote indigenous communities.

AUD/USD reaction

The AUD/USD pair consolidates the sharp rise above the 0.59 handle, as the bulls take a breather amid RBA’s liquidity funding, Fed balance sheet expansion and rebound in oil prices.

The spot, currently, trades at 0.5840, having hit a daily high of 0.5911 while maintaining the recovery from 0.5665 low.
